AL-KHOBAR - A
Lawyer has called for setting up
special courts to look into
corruption cases to reduce the time general
courts take for processing such cases. The long court proceedings give corrupt officials an opportunity to escape justice, he said, adding that the long process leaves many legal loopholes and the system fails to deter the "thieves" from playing with justice.
